French President Emmanuel Macron delivers a press conference after a European Council summit held over video-conference at the Elysee Palace in Paris, France, March 25, 2021. — Reuters picBRUSSELS, March 26 — EU leaders voiced frustration yesterday over a massive shortfall in contracted deliveries of AstraZeneca Covid-19 vaccines, as a third wave of infections surged across Europe.

“The company has to catch up, has to honour the contract it has with the European member states, before it can engage again in exporting vaccines,” she said. This week, the European Commission unveiled plans to tighten oversight of vaccine exports. This would allow greater scope to block shipments to countries with higher inoculation rates.

The EU says it should share more, notably to help make up the shortfall in contracted deliveries of AstraZeneca shots
